Product Overview
Imax-S Injection is an iron supplement used to treat iron-deficiency anemia, a condition where the body lacks enough iron to produce an adequate amount of red blood cells. These cells are essential for carrying oxygen throughout the body, and insufficient iron can lead to fatigue, weakness, and other health issues.
The injection is administered through a slow intravenous drip by a healthcare professional. Your doctor will determine the appropriate dosage and the number of sessions needed to correct the anemia. Alongside this treatment, following a diet rich in iron can further support recovery. Iron-rich foods include pulses, leafy greens like spinach, beans, eggs, dry fruits, and animal-based products.
Some people may experience side effects such as changes in taste, high blood pressure, nausea, and discomfort at the injection site, including pain, swelling, or redness. A temporary drop in blood pressure may occur if the infusion is given too quickly. Medical staff will monitor you during the treatment for allergic reactions such as difficulty breathing, dizziness, swelling of the face, or hives. If side effects persist or worsen, you should seek medical advice.
This medication is not suitable for treating anemia caused by factors other than iron deficiency. It is important to inform your doctor if you have conditions like rheumatoid arthritis, asthma, allergies, high blood pressure, or liver disease, as these may impact your treatment plan. The safety of this medication during pregnancy and breastfeeding has not been fully established, so consult your healthcare provider for guidance. Regular blood tests will be conducted to monitor iron levels, track progress, and watch for any adverse effects. Avoiding alcohol during treatment may also be recommended.

Possible Side Effects
Most side effects are mild and resolve as your body adapts to the treatment. Consult your doctor if any symptoms continue or cause discomfort. Common side effects include:
Altered taste
Pain, swelling, or redness at the injection site
Nausea
Temporary low blood pressure
High blood pressure

How It Works
Imax-S Injection replenishes the iron reserves in the body, which are essential for producing red blood cells and hemoglobin—the component responsible for transporting oxygen throughout the body.
Safety Guidelines
Alcohol: It is advised not to consume alcohol during treatment with this injection, as it may lead to adverse effects.
Pregnancy: Use only if prescribed by your doctor. Animal studies indicate minimal risk, but human studies are limited.
Breastfeeding: Safe if prescribed by your doctor. Available data suggest that the drug does not pass into breastmilk in significant amounts.
Driving: This medication may cause drowsiness, dizziness, or impaired vision. Avoid driving if you experience these symptoms.
Kidney Disease: Use cautiously in patients with kidney issues. Dose adjustments may be required under medical supervision.
Liver Disease: Exercise caution if you have liver problems. Your doctor may recommend dose adjustments after assessing your condition.
